    • An anti-miss alarm system, method, and a shoe supporting the anti-miss alarm is provided. The anti-miss alarm method receives a radio signal emitted from a portable article having an interface for a wireless personal area network (WPAN), extracts channel status information from the radio signal, calculates a relative distance from the portable article based on the channel status information, and outputs alarm signals in a stepwise manner according to the relative distance. A mobile terminal includes an interface of a WPAN, a control unit, and an output unit. The interface receives radio signals emitted from a portable article having a similar interface. The control unit extracts channel status information from the radio signals and estimates a relative distance from the portable article based on the channel status information. The output unit controllably outputs alarm signals in a stepwise manner according to the relative distance. The shoe is similar

    • An IGBT includes a first silicon region over a collector region, and a plurality of pillars of first and second conductivity types arranged in an alternating manner over the first silicon region. The IGBT further includes a plurality of well regions each extending over and being in electrical contact with one of the pillars of the first conductivity type, and a plurality of gate electrodes each extending over a portion of a corresponding well region. The physical dimensions of each of the first and second conductivity type pillars and the doping concentration of charge carriers in each of the first and second conductivity type pillars are selected so as to create a charge imbalance between a net charge in each pillar of first conductivity and a net charge in its adjacent pillar of the second conductivity type.

    • The present invention relates to a light emitting device for preventing cross-talk phenomenon. The light emitting device includes a plurality of pixels and a scan driving circuit. The pixels are formed in cross areas of data lines and scan lines. The scan driving circuit couples at least one scan line to a first voltage source having a first voltage during a first time, couples the scan line to a second voltage source having a second voltage during a second time, and couples the scan line to a third voltage source having a third voltage during a third time. Here, the second voltage is a voltage between the first voltage and the third voltage. The light emitting device discharges the data lines to the same level as data current irrespective of precharge current, and thus cross-talk phenomenon is not occurred to the light emitting device.

    • Provided are a mobile extensible Markup Language (XML) signature service providing apparatus and method. The mobile XML signature service providing apparatus includes: an XML message analyzing unit authenticating a mobile client, according to an XML signature template generation request or an XML signature verification request received from the mobile client; an XML signature processor generating an XML signature template and a SignedInfo element in a canonicalized format if the authentication is successful, and verifying an XML signature; and an encoder providing key information and at least one setting value for the generation of the XML signature template and verification of the XML signature, to the XML signature processor. Therefore, the mobile XML signature service providing apparatus and method provide authentication, integrity, non-repudiation, etc. with respect to messages received/transmitted in a wireless environment, are applied to a wireless environment having limited resources, are compatible with an XML signature for an existing wired environment that is to be applied to wired-and-wireless integration electronic commerce, and minimizes a change in an existing wired environment when a mobile XML signature is applied.

    • Provided is a parallel program execution method in which in order to reflect structural characteristics of a multithreaded processor-based parallel system, performance of the parallel loop is predicted while compiling or executing using a performance prediction model and then the parallel program is executed using an adaptive execution method. The method includes the steps of: generating as many threads as the number of physical processors of the parallel system in order to execute at least one parallel loop contained in the parallel program; by the generated threads, executing at least one single loop of each parallel loop; measuring an execution time, the number of executed instructions, and the number of cache misses for each parallel loop; determining an execution mode of each parallel loop by determining the number of threads used to execute each parallel loop based on the measured values; and allocating the threads to each physical processor according to the result of the determination to execute each parallel loop. The method significantly improves the performance of the parallel program driven in the multithreaded processor-based parallel system.
